Pesto Pizza

One of my favorite and healthier take on pizza includes this pesto-based pizza. Pesto has great flavor and is a lighter way to enjoy one of your favorite meals…and the kids will love it too!

Ingredients

For Pizza:

  • 2 each ready-to-eat pizza crust (I used Boboli Mini Pizza Crust)
  • Olive Oil
  • 3/4 cup pesto
  • 1 cup mozzarella cheese shredded
  • 1 large sweet pepper seeded and sliced
  • 1/4 cup sunflower seed kernels

For Dipping Sauce:

  • 1 cup plain non-fat Greek yogurt
  • 1 packet ranch dip seasoning season to your taste

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 450 degrees F. 
  • On a clean surface, remove crust from package and brush both sides with olive oil. 
  • Pour ½ cup pesto on each crust, fully covering the crust. 
  • Sprinkle ½ cup mozzarella on each pizza. Add a few sweet pepper slices and sprinkle with sunflower seeds (or make a smiley face!) 
  • Bake in oven for 10-12 minutes, or until crust edges are golden brown. Let cool and enjoy!
